We love coming here to pick up bagels for an event or grab a cheap, yet filling breakfast or lunch. If you can find a tome that they're not busy, you're doing good, otherwise you may have to wait awhile. This is also pretty dependent on who's running the machines or making sandwiches though. When you arrive, you grab a number and then a clipboard to fill out your order. When it's your turn, the cashier will ring it up and get your bagels. You can't go wrong with any of the bagels, or really sandwiches for that matter. The most unique, and best in our opinion though, is their new everything bagel. All the goodness of an everything, without the mess. The only issue why this isn't a five star for us anymore is the hit-or-miss service. Mainly the last 3 times we've been there part of our order was wrong. This most recent we ended up with a regular everything bagel, instead of the new everything bagel that we asked for and there wasn't any sauce on our sandwiches. The two prior times we were also missing ingredients on our sandwiches. Not sure if this is on the inputting in the system or the person making the sandwiches, but just something we've noticed.

Bagels Forever has always been one of my favorite spots in Madison. The quality and prices are unmatched. The bagels are so fresh and delicious! They also freeze really well. Their cream cheese is my absolute favorite. I love their plain whipped cream cheese and their strawberry cream cheese is the best I've ever had. I usually order either a breakfast or lunch bagel sandwich or a toasted plain bagel with strawberry cream cheese. And a bonus if you get a sandwich it comes with a really good pickle on the side. They have a parking lot making it easy to park. When you arrive if the line is long you can grab a number and that's how they flow through the line. Even if there's a long line they move pretty quick. Note, this is just a grab and go spot. They don't have any seating. Highly recommend!

You know a place is good if you come there multiple times on a 3 day trip to another city. Bagels forever is probably the best bagel spot I've had in my life. Ordering is simple, walk up to the cashier and tell them what type of bun you want and what you want in between. You can get toppings and the bagel toasted as well. Then just wait 3-7 minutes depending on how busy they are and pick up and enjoy your bagel. The lox bagel is probably my favorite that I've gotten here. The salmon is really nice and pairs well with the bagel and cream cheese. The breakfast sandwiches are also really tasty. The best thing about this place is it's affordability. A sandwich can cost from $3-5, so you could feel full for $7-10, which is great value in Madison. If you are into bagels or just want to try something new, definitely check out bagels forever.
